X-Man is the Age of Apocalypse's version of Cable. He is free from the Techno-Organic disease that plagued Cable. Edit


Created in the "AGE OF APOCALYPSE" timeline X-man is one of only a handful to survive his end. Genetically engineered from Scott Summers (Cyclops) and Jean Grey by Mr. Sinister. Nate Grey has enormous powers of telepathy and telekinesis that make him potentially the most powerful mutant on Earth. In fact the sheer magnitude of his power is more than his body can take, hence if a cure is not found it could kill him. In his reality Nate Grey viewed Forge as a father figure until he was killed by Sinister. Nate took his revenge towards the end of "AGE OF APOCALYPSE", by mortaly wounding Sinister. In a final showdown between X-Man and Holocaust, Nate drove a piece of the M'Kraan Crystal into his chest. Unexpectedly it brought them to the current timeline.

Upon entering this timeline, Nate found himself confused and disorientated. He found himself drawn to the Madelyne Pryor, the clone of Jean Grey which was thought to have perished during the Inferno. The Goblin Queen helped Nate adjust to the new enviroment of a world not ruled by Apocalypse.

Early attempts at contact from Professor X and Cable proved to meet with resistance from the young rebel mutant. Memories of Sinister's manipulations still fresh in his mind kept him from trusting anyone trying to "help" him with his powers. Nate lashed out at everyone who tried to come to his aid, thinking that everyone was trying to use him for his powers. Nate even fought Professor X on the astral plane. Despite being much younger than the Professor, he tore the man's astral form from his body giving the psionic monster called Onslaught a chance to take over his body. This set him lose onto he world. Nate, himself, ended being captured by the Earth-616 Mister Sinister because of his helping hand in freeing Onslaught. Before Sinister could do anything to Nate he was taken by Onslaught who intended to us him for his powers. Thankfully the monster was beaten by the worlds heroes, causing most of them to die for awhile until they where brought back by Franklin Richards. After this Nate was upset. So far everyone he met in this new world had used him for his powers.

When he learned of a few AoA people like himself had crossed over he went after them, mainly Dark Beast and the Sugar Man. He had a few more bad run-ins with people and began to mistrust them even more. Nate did all he could to avoided contact with anyone involved with the X-Men.

But after a while Nate began to trust the people in this new world he and bonded with a few people including the real Jean Grey and Cyclops and his alternate brother Cable. After a while he encountered the Goblin Queen again when a huge telepathic wave disabled all all active telepaths. He traveled with her for a while seeing that he was dependent on her much more that he was when he came to the new world. Then he found out that the Madelyne he was with was not even Madelyne Pryor. The person he was with was an alternate version of an evil Queen, Jean Grey that was the ruler of another dimension. She went to different worlds trying to find Nate Greys. She saw them as the ultimate Telekinetic weapon. She took Nate back to her own dimension where he escaped and found another Nate Grey that was able to hide from the Queen as a shaman. He used his powers to hide. This stunned our Nate since the other Nate was just like him, his powers where meant to drain him and kill him. But this Nate had a genetic brand that stopped his powers from killing him, a gift of the evil Queen that lured him to her. Together they tried to fight the Queen but in the end they switched traits. The other Nate was killed by the Queen and the Nate from Earth-616 got the genetic brand that stopped his powers from killing him. No longer having to hold back he lashed out and killed the evil Queen.

Nate returned to our world and became a shaman and sought to bring peace to the world man and mutant. Nate was called to save the world from an almost unbeatable threat. An alien being called Harvest who wanted the earth's energies. Nate found a way to dissolve himself along with Harvest into energy that merged with every person on the planet, just in case more of Harvest's people came to Earth. Since Nate's powers where seen as impure by the aliens, they left the Earth alone. Nate became one with everybody on Earth and he lost his own body. Nate became psychic energy and died.
